Buyer
OnLogic
As a Buyer, you are a key part of the Operations team within the Global Supply Chain team. Based out of our Taiwan office, a key part of your role is to manage inventory planning and supplier delivery schedules in order to meet customer demand. This will require managing supplier purchase orders/delivery schedules, product costs, supplier relationships, and optimizing inventory levels.
Job Responsibilities
I. Procurement:
- Monitoring and managing purchase orders (POs), prepay, pull-in and push-out requirements, and inventory levels to ensure timely availability of materials and components.
- Setting up and managing vendor managed inventory (VMI) programs, negotiating MOQs, and leading end of life (EOL) management of obsolescence materials and components inventory.
- Running RFQs/RFPs and negotiating contracts with suppliers to secure the best possible pricing and terms & conditions.
- Researching and evaluating potential suppliers based on quality, cost, and delivery capabilities.
- Developing and implementing procurement strategies for assigned materials and suppliers to optimize costs and lead times.
- Staying up-to-date on industry trends and best practices in procurement.
- Ensuring compliance with all relevant procurement regulations and policies.
- Negotiate price, MOQ, lead time, payment terms, excess fees, and cancellation fees
- Maintain and review lead times and MOQs monthly and quarterly
II. Supplier Relationship Management:
- Building and maintaining strong relationships with suppliers to foster collaboration, compliance and continuous improvement.
- Running supplier reviews (QBRs), understanding the market, mitigating risk, supporting data collection & analytics, and contract management, including NDAs, price sheets & SOWs.
- Managing supplier communications and key activities for assigned materials, suppliers and new product development projects (NPD).
- Regular meetings with suppliers to review delivery schedules
III. Cross-Functional Collaboration & Support:
- Collaborating with cross-functional teams to identify and prioritize purchasing needs.
- Supporting OEM/ODM projects and collaborating with the engineering team
- Interacting with the finance team for supplier payment and invoice processing
- Responding to and resolving supply chain tickets
- Supporting engineering changes (ECs) by obtaining updated BOMs and drawings, assessing impact on open orders, inventory, and rework fees for new unit pricing, and updating ERP.
IV. Planning & Forecasting:
Inventory planning and optimization (following DDMRP methodology)
Supply planning and delivery schedule management
New SKU enablement
Requirements
- Bachelor's degree in Supply Chain, Business, Economics, Logistics or related field.
- At least 5-8 years purchasing/supply chain experience.
- Experience using ERP systems (SAP, JDE, Oracle, etc.), (MRP and DDMRP) related to procurement; you understand supplier capacity planning and how to build a material delivery schedule based on customer order and inventory stocking level requirements.
- Knowledge of CM/ODM/OEM/COTS, price negotiations, and purchase order creation and management
- Experience and knowledge with computer hardware manufacturing
- Professional Proficiency level of English

The team you will be joining:
Our Operations team is responsible for building, testing, packaging and shipping OnLogic systems around the world. Their tireless attention to detail, and commitment to quality lets us boast about how reliable and configurable our systems are. Members of the Operations team cross-train on multiple disciplines to provide us with unparalleled staffing flexibility and the capability to react to any production demand. Always living up the way we work through continuous improvement and process optimization, Operations is where project plans and technical specifications become a reality. Roles on the Operations team include computer production, hardware testing, fulfillment services, supply chain management, product and process quality, production engineering and technical support.
